#a28fb5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a28fb5 is composed of 63.5% red, 56.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.5% cyan, 21%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 20.4% and a lightness of 63.5%. #a28fb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#451f6b.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#a28fb5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050406 is the darkest color, while #faf9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a28fb5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29da7 is the less saturated color, while #a247fd is the most saturated one.
